Date:1838 - 1902 (c.)

Description:Friendly Society banner from Long Itchington. The banner is silk with wool detailing and has a gold-painted inscription and decoration. It is pennant shaped with a fringe along the bottom edge, which has been squared-off at the end with a long yellow woollen tassle. The right side is of dark blue silk with a yellow wool border. The inscription reads 'FEAR GOD HONOUR THE QUEEN / UNION IS STRENGTH'. There is a foliate border around the wording with two hands clasping in the top corner. There are three rosettes of red and blue silk in the bottom corners and top right corner. The left side of the banner is dark pink/faded red silk with a border and fringe. The inscription reads 'LONG ITCHINGTON FRIENDLY / SOCIETY ESTABLISHED 1838' and has a foliate border around the wording. There are two hands clasping in the top corner. There are small areas of damage and some soiling as well as fading in places, c.1838-1902.
